<p>To use the mobile application development tool <a href="http://www.appcelerator.com/products/titanium-mobile-application-development/" target="_self">Titanium Appcelerator</a> requires knowledge of JavaScript.</p>
<p>Expanding upon <a href="http://www.handshake20.com/2011/03/when-using-titanium-appcelerator-think-of-mobile-apps-as-star-belly-sneetches.html" target="_self">this Dr. Seuss analogy that Titanium Appcelerator works for mobile apps like McBean's machine works for Sneetches</a>, if mobile apps are thought of as the Star-Belly Sneetches, then the JavaScript code can be understood to be a Plain-Belly Sneetch. Placed into McBean's Machine, a.k.a. Titanium Appcelerator, a single "plain" app written in JavaScript is transformed into two "star" apps written in Objective-C (iOS) and Java (Android).</p>
<p>Despite their similar names, JavaScript is not to be confused with the Java programming language. However, it is helpful to think of JavaScript as an object-oriented language, just like Java. "Thinking object-oriented" allows for the encapsulation of data within objects as well as functions and methods to interact with individual objects.</p>
<p><a href="http://annegilesclelland.typepad.com/.a/6a00e54f923408883301675f4b8b71970b-pi"><img alt="JavaScript" src="http://annegilesclelland.typepad.com/.a/6a00e54f923408883301675f4b8b71970b-500wi" style="width: 500px; display: block;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to;" title="JavaScript" /></a><br />"Thinking object-oriented" also allows for easier management of the various aspects of graphical user interfaces (GUIs), including those within mobile apps. Buttons, tabs, text fields and windows all have different purposes and perform separate tasks and, therefore, can be thought of as separate objects. Being part of a GUI, they are all designed to be interacted with and the use of various methods and functions makes this interaction possible.</p>
<p>Titanium Appcelerator’s modular approach to the design process makes the development of apps with their software much more object-oriented. It provides users with numerous <a href="http://www.handshake20.com/2010/05/api-just-draw-me-a-picture.html" target="_self">application programming interfaces (APIs)</a> that contain many of the common components for GUI implementation, both <a href="http://developer.appcelerator.com/apidoc/desktop/latest" target="_self">desktop </a>and <a href="http://developer.appcelerator.com/apidoc/mobile/latest" target="_self">mobile</a>. These APIs enable the metaphorical Dr. Seuss magic to occur when developing mobile apps. They transform the JavaScript written by the programmers into separate code for the two operating systems, or should I say they transform the Plain-Belly Sneetches into those with “stars upon thars.”</p>

<p>In the early days of doing business in 2012, we're not asking as we did in 2009, <a href="http://www.handshake20.com/2009/11/tech-showcase-have-you-googled-yourself-lately.html" target="_self">"Have you Googled yourself?"</a> but stating what savvy business people think to themselves after that first word-of-mouth (WOM) referral or that first handshake of introduction: "I will Google you."</p>
<p><em>A version of <a href="http://www.handshake20.com/2012/01/i-will-google-you.html" target="_self">I Will Google You</a> first appeared on Handshake 2.0.</em></p>
<p>In the physical world of business, "It's who you know" begins introductory handshakes that can lead to handshakes on deals.</p>
<p>In the online world of business, "It's still who you know" begins a knowledge-based consideration of a handshake. But how to get known? We founded <a href="http://www.handshake20.com/" target="_self">Handshake 2.0</a> with "It's still who you know" as a tagline to assist good companies in sharing good information about their good companies to help them get known well.</p>
<p><a href="http://annegilesclelland.typepad.com/.a/6a00e54f92340888330168e4d97a5a970c-pi" style="float: right;"><img alt="Anne Googling" src="http://annegilesclelland.typepad.com/.a/6a00e54f92340888330168e4d97a5a970c-250wi" style="margin: 0px 0px 5px 5px; width: 250px;" title="Anne Googling" /></a>We may need to change Handshake 2.0's tagline to this: "It's still who you know - and it's what they know."</p>
<p>If someone in my "It's who you know" network introduces me to you for that introductory handshake and the first impression was a good one, I will return to my office and Google you.</p>
<p>I will Google your name, your company's name, your name + your company's name, your company's name + your industry, etc.</p>
<p>Why am I using Google to get to "know" you? Two reasons.</p>
<p><strong>1) I want to decrease business risk. </strong></p>
<p>I want to see what's online about you to learn that you are who you say you are, that your company truly exists, and that what you say about yourself and what others say about you match my impression. The more due diligence-based trust I can place in you and your corporate practices, the less risk I take.</p>
<p><strong>2) I want to increase competitive advantage. </strong></p>
<p>I am finding Shoshana Zuboff's assertion in <a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/0142003883/ref=as_li_tf_tl?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=handsh20-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=9325&amp;creativeASIN=0142003883">The Support Economy</a> to be increasingly true: there are two economies, one in the physical world, one online, and my company needs to operate strategically in both. I Google you to learn that your company is operating competitively in its industry both online and off. I want to learn that doing business with your company would be good for my company.</p>
<p>When I find your company's site, I'm glad to see Twitter and Facebook icons, but I click or tap through to see how active you are in social media. I look for the quantity and quality of your activity. My company needs your company to be participating in "both economies." If you're not competitive in one whole economy, that makes doing business with you less advantageous than doing business with someone who is competitive in both.</p>
<p>Handshake 2.0 is an enterprise of Handshake Media, Incorporated and as Handshake Media's representative, I will be extending handshakes of greeting in both the physical and online worlds of business in 2012. I look forward to meeting you. I will return to my office later and Google you. If we're at a business luncheon and the meeting is boring, with my smartphone, I won't wait. Within minutes of meeting you, I'll be Googling you.</p>

&lt;p style="text-align: center;"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;VT KnowledgeWorks Success Showcase: TORC Robotics&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Company’s Full Name: &lt;strong&gt;&lt;a href="http://www.torcrobotics.com" target="_self"&gt;TORC Robotics, LLC&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Year Founded:&amp;nbsp; 2005&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Year Company Entered VT KnowledgeWorks: 2006&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Total Number of&amp;nbsp; Employees When Entered: 2&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Total Number of Employees to Date:&amp;nbsp;32&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Overview of Company’s Products/Services, and Significance to the Market&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;TORC changes the way mobile robotic systems are designed, integrated, tested and deployed by empowering engineers with a suite of modular, customizable products. TORC’s Robotic Building Blocks product line is used by leading academic, commercial and government organizations to shorten the development process, lower costs and mitigate risks. These products have been used on more than 100 mobile robots ranging from 15 pounds to 15 tons. TORC provides by-wire and autonomous vehicle kits, as well as individual products and custom solutions for drive-by-wire conversion, emergency stop, power management, autonomous navigation and operator control.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Traditionally, engineers have relied on products that were not intended for use in robotic applications. This approach created system integration problems, escalating development costs, poor reliability, and limited performance. As a result, robotics technologies have struggled to transition out of research laboratories to real-world applications. TORC helps solve these problems with a line of safe, reliable, and customizable products specifically designed for engineers of robotic systems.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;This product-based approach has enabled customers to accelerate their development efforts, stay focused on solving their problems or developing new technologies, and reduce overall project costs. From developing cars that enable the blind to drive to autonomous ground vehicles that lighten the load of our Warfighters, TORC products are used in a wide variety of robotic systems.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Company Accomplishments&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Since entering the VT KnowledgeWorks program in 2006, TORC has grown significantly in revenues, employees, office space and market presence.&amp;nbsp; Originally a two person operation working on small research contracts, TORC has quickly become a leading provider of unmanned and autonomous vehicle technologies. TORC continues to grow year over year, attract and retain a high caliber workforce in the region, and provide excellent internship opportunities for a number of engineering students from Virginia Tech each year.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;In 2007, TORC partnered with Virginia Tech in the DARPA Urban Challenge and led the software development that allowed Odin, the team’s fully autonomous Ford Escape Hybrid, to navigate complex urban traffic situations without human intervention.&amp;nbsp; Odin finished the 60-mile race in third place, minutes behind teams from Stanford and Carnegie Mellon.&amp;nbsp; The team was awarded the 2008 Graphical System Design Achievement Award in Robotics from National Instruments for the use of their LabVIEW graphical programming environment in the development of the award-winning autonomous vehicle.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Since its success in the DARPA Urban Challenge, TORC has been engaged in a growing number of contracts to transition unmanned and autonomous vehicle technologies to commercial and military applications.&amp;nbsp; One of the more prominent examples has been the Ground Unmanned Support Surrogate (GUSS) project for the Marine Corps Warfighting Laboratory.&amp;nbsp; TORC’s product line and engineering services were used in the development of four optionally unmanned ground vehicles designed to support dismounted Marines with missions such as autonomous resupply, casualty evacuation, and to “lighten the load,” among other capabilities.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;In 2008, TORC won the prestigious Roanoke-Blacksburg Technology Council (formerly NewVa Corridor Technology Council) “Rising Star Award” in recognition of its growth, cutting edge products and services and its current and future impact on the local economy.&amp;nbsp; In the same year, TORC was also nominated and selected as the winner of the 2008 Donna Noble Outstanding Virginia Incubator Client Award.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;center&gt;
&lt;iframe width="640" height="360" src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/Z2ciYRB2roA"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en&gt;&lt;/iframe&gt;
&lt;/center&gt;
&lt;p&gt;In early 2010 Virginia Tech’s Robotics and Mechanisms Laboratory (RoMeLa) partnered with TORC to provide its ByWire XGV mobile robotics research platform, along with other sensing, perception and route planning technologies, to integrate with RoMeLa’s non-visual interfaces for the National Federation of the Blind’s Blind Driver Challenge®. This allowed for the first full-sized blind drivable vehicle to be demonstrated on January 29, 2011, when a blind driver successfully navigated 1.5 miles of the Daytona International Speedway, reaching top speeds of 27 mph and navigating obstacles. This effort resulted in major media coverage including the Today Show, MotorWeek, Bloomberg, Anderson Cooper 360, Popular Science magazine and more. This was recently written up in an article by Mashable titled “7 Tech Breakthroughs That Empower People With Disabilities.”&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Over the last few years, TORC has been selected to participate in several programs sponsored by the Virginia Economic Development Partnership designed to help promising Virginia-based companies increase export sales and expand into international markets.&amp;nbsp; In 2009 TORC was nominated to participate in the year long “Accessing International Markets” program and was recently selected as one of a small number of Virginia companies for the 2011-2012 “State Trade Export Promotion” initiative.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;TORC has a strong record of commercializing robotic technologies into products.&amp;nbsp; Through a balance between work with the DoD, industry and internal research and development, TORC has commercialized eight robotic products over the last four years and are used on platforms ranging from 15 lbs to 15 tons, from speeds of 1 mph to 102 mph, and by customers in defense, mining, automotive, agriculture, security and academic markets.&amp;nbsp; The TORC product line provides modular, interoperable and scalable “Robotic Building Blocks” to rapidly upfit platforms with unmanned and/or autonomous capability.&lt;/p&gt;
